A post-registration steering group (PRSSG) at the Nursing and Midwifery Council (NMC) has recommended the regulator develop new standards of proficiency for three fields of Specialist Community Public Health Nursing (SCPHN): school nurses, occupational health nurses and health … We first published the Standards of proficiency for specialist community public health nurses (SCPHNs) in 2004.These standards set out both the proficiencies (the skills and knowledge a SCPHN needs), and the standards for education and training (how a university will train and educate SCPHN students).
